Fine-Tuning Product Regimens for Warmer Days
Among one of the most effective ways to revitalize a skincare procedure is by reconsidering the products your clients utilize daily. As temperatures rise, heavy occlusive products may no more offer them well. Take into consideration advising lighter hydration and changing from abundant moisturizers to gel-based or water-based options.
Cleansing is one more essential area where subtle adjustments can make a substantial distinction. In the springtime, the skin may produce even more oil and sweat, specifically with raised activity and time outdoors. Suggest stabilizing cleansers that sustain the skin barrier while thoroughly getting rid of contaminations. Motivate clients to avoid harsh removing products, which can trigger even more oil manufacturing and sensitivity.
Of course, SPF is non-negotiable year-round, yet spring is a perfect time to double down on sunlight protection. With longer daytime hours and more time invested outside, a broad-spectrum SPF ought to be part of every early morning routine. Deal clients alternatives that feel light-weight and breathable to support everyday wear.

Addressing Seasonal Skin Stressors Head-On
Spring isn't just sunlight and roses. It additionally brings seasonal allergic reactions, raised plant pollen, and a greater probability of irritability or flare-ups. As an aggressive skincare professional, expect these issues and build preventative measures right into your customer protocols.
Look for indicators of animated skin, such as redness, dry skin, or itching, particularly in clients vulnerable to seasonal allergic reactions. Focus on relaxing components and barrier assistance. Recommend way of living modifications, such as washing the face after being outdoors, to minimize allergen direct exposure.
Hydration remains crucial, also as humidity increases. But hydration does not need to indicate hefty. Motivate making use of hydrating mists, products with hyaluronic acid, and lightweight creams that absorb swiftly while maintaining the skin plump.
